Question

How to fix internet connection issues on laptop?

To fix internet connection issues on your laptop, you can follow several methods that address different potential causes of the problem. Here are some effective approaches:

  1. Check Wi-Fi Connection: Ensure that your laptop's Wi-Fi is turned on and that you are connected to the correct network. Sometimes, simply disconnecting and reconnecting can resolve the issue.

  2. Restart Your Devices: Restart your laptop and your router. This can clear temporary glitches that may be affecting your connection.

  3. Run Network Troubleshooter: Windows has a built-in network troubleshooter that can automatically detect and fix common connectivity issues. To access it, go to Settings > Network & Internet > Status, and click on 'Network troubleshooter'.

  4. Update Network Drivers: Outdated or corrupted network drivers can lead to connection issues. You can update your drivers by going to Device Manager, finding your network adapter, right-clicking, and selecting 'Update driver'.

  5. Check Firewall and Antivirus Settings: Sometimes, firewall or antivirus software can block your internet connection. Temporarily disable them to see if they are causing the issue. If this resolves the problem, adjust the settings to allow your connection.

  6. Reset Network Settings: If all else fails, resetting your network settings can help. This will remove all saved networks and reset your network configurations. To do this, go to Settings > Network & Internet > Status, and select 'Network reset'.

Each of these methods addresses different aspects of connectivity issues, from hardware settings to software configurations. It's important to systematically go through these steps to identify the root cause of the problem effectively.
